"So far, 366 people from Iraq and Syria have been repatriated in stages," said Ali Naghiyev, the head of the State Security Service of the Republic of Azerbaijan and the Chairman of the State Commission on Prisoners of War, Hostages and Missing Person, APA reports.

The chairman of the commission said that appropriate measures were taken to repatriate and rehabilitate the families of those detained in Iraq and Syria, especially women and children, who took part in the fighting as part of illegal armed groups during the armed conflicts in the Middle East.
